The area of Kruger National Park includes over 20 nature reserves, dedicated to the conservation of wildlife and the protection of one of the last remaining wildlife sanctuaries in the world.
The entire area covers nearly 5.5 million acres of unfenced land, where animals roam freely across the savannah.

Volunteers will stay in a private lodge located within the Mtimkulu Private Reserve, part of the Greater Kruger area, nestled in the heart of the African savanna. The accommodation combines spacious safari tents and shared dormitories, offering an authentic yet comfortable bush experience.
The camp is designed as a research base, created not only to provide comfort but also to encourage learning and community living. Facilities include shared bathrooms with showers and toilets, an outdoor fire pit for “braais” (traditional South African barbecues), communal relaxation areas, and a shared dining space where volunteers can enjoy meals and exchange stories from their day. The lodge offers free Wi-Fi, though the connection can be variable. Volunteers can purchase a local SIM card (MTN recommended) to stay connected. The property also features a swimming pool and an outdoor area ideal for stargazing and socializing after daily activities.
Two meals per day and a self-service breakfast are provided from Monday to Friday, while no meals are included on weekends. All meals are prepared with fresh ingredients and adapted to life in the reserve.

Projects dedicated to the conservation of wildlife and flora within the Greater Kruger reserve, one of the most diverse and spectacular natural areas on the continent. Volunteers work alongside experienced guides and researchers in the protection of the “Big Five” – elephants, lions, leopards, rhinos, and buffaloes – contributing to data collection and the monitoring of animals.
